Skip to content

Commit

Permalink
Merge pull request #39 from sanjay-reddy-kandi/main
Browse files Browse the repository at this point in the history
Release v1.8.10
  • Loading branch information
abewub authored Aug 7, 2024
2 parents 39c2c51 + 3553788 commit 2e79c65
Show file tree
Hide file tree
Showing 10 changed files with 6,302 additions and 5,866 deletions.
4 changes: 4 additions & 0 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
Expand Up @@ -5,6 +5,10 @@ All notable changes to this project will be documented in this file.
The format is based on [Keep a Changelog](https://keepachangelog.com/en/1.0.0/),
and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.html).

## [1.8.10] - 2024-08-07
### Changed
- Upgraded fast-xml-parser to mitigate CVE-2024-41818

## [1.8.9] - 2024-07-10
### Changed
- Upgraded braces to mitigate CVE-2024-4068
Expand Down
3 changes: 2 additions & 1 deletion solution-manifest.yaml
Original file line number Diff line number Diff line change
@@ -1,7 +1,8 @@
---
id: SO0143 # Solution Id
name: devops-monitoring-dashboard-on-aws # trademarked name
version: v1.8.9 # current version of the solution. Used to verify template headers
opensource_archive: aws-devops-monitoring-dashboard.zip
version: v1.8.10 # current version of the solution. Used to verify template headers
cloudformation_templates: # This list should match with AWS CloudFormation templates section of IG
- template: aws-devops-monitoring-dashboard.template
main_template: true
Expand Down
2,912 changes: 1,474 additions & 1,438 deletions source/lambda/event_parser/npm-shrinkwrap.json

Large diffs are not rendered by default.

3,854 changes: 2,016 additions & 1,838 deletions source/lambda/multi_account_custom_resources/npm-shrinkwrap.json

Large diffs are not rendered by default.

3,353 changes: 1,723 additions & 1,630 deletions source/lambda/query_runner/npm-shrinkwrap.json

Large diffs are not rendered by default.

2,018 changes: 1,071 additions & 947 deletions source/lambda/tag_query/npm-shrinkwrap.json

Large diffs are not rendered by default.

4 changes: 2 additions & 2 deletions source/npm-shrinkwrap.json

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

2 changes: 1 addition & 1 deletion source/package.json
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
{
"name": "aws_devops_monitoring_dashboard",
"description": "CDK app to provision AWS resources for the solution",
"version": "1.8.9",
"version": "1.8.10",
"bin": {
"aws_devops_monitoring_dashboard": "bin/aws_devops_monitoring_dashboard.js"
},
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-447,7 +447,7 @@ exports[`Snapshot test for primary devopsDashboardStack 1`] = `
"S3Bucket": {
"Fn::Sub": "cdk-hnb659fds-assets-\${AWS::AccountId}-\${AWS::Region}",
},
"S3Key": "abc87bd4517df441ed5309fbcfb9ab524c534140bb36466f4a048f003ca8119b.zip",
"S3Key": "1c5ebab0200a0dfa0fce2de4d1bacdc859692a8e4d909e125b93845a9a77b662.zip",
},
"Description": "DevOps Monitoring Dashboard on AWS solution - This function runs on a daily schedule and adds a new partition to Amazon Athena table",
"Environment": {
Expand Down Expand Up @@ -1122,7 +1122,7 @@ exports[`Snapshot test for primary devopsDashboardStack 1`] = `
"S3Bucket": {
"Fn::Sub": "cdk-hnb659fds-assets-\${AWS::AccountId}-\${AWS::Region}",
},
"S3Key": "988d6a83d1cb17697e7f9d239ca7089b2310e30e1a432a2d33f3caddf135b3d7.zip",
"S3Key": "240e359dfbddd5a1f34a91445a3224f32a4fb1859012c760306c1e654e3b65f5.zip",
},
"Description": "DevOps Monitoring Dashboard on AWS solution - This function performs lambda transformation within kinesis firehose. It parses CloudWatch metrics for CodeBuild, sends relevant data to S3 for downstream operation",
"Environment": {
Expand Down Expand Up @@ -2545,7 +2545,7 @@ exports[`Snapshot test for primary devopsDashboardStack 1`] = `
"S3Bucket": {
"Fn::Sub": "cdk-hnb659fds-assets-\${AWS::AccountId}-\${AWS::Region}",
},
"S3Key": "988d6a83d1cb17697e7f9d239ca7089b2310e30e1a432a2d33f3caddf135b3d7.zip",
"S3Key": "240e359dfbddd5a1f34a91445a3224f32a4fb1859012c760306c1e654e3b65f5.zip",
},
"Description": "DevOps Monitoring Dashboard on AWS solution - This function performs lambda transformation within kinesis firehose. It parses raw cloudwatch events, sends relevant data to S3 for downstream operation",
"Environment": {
Expand Down Expand Up @@ -2718,7 +2718,7 @@ exports[`Snapshot test for primary devopsDashboardStack 1`] = `
{
"Fn::Sub": "cdk-hnb659fds-assets-\${AWS::AccountId}-\${AWS::Region}",
},
"/dc8096752a98d71d58868948b9516bad22b592538280dbf735c930a15d0e649f.json",
"/6a7f795e43e0139b1144186492f0874070c3c0cf88af9b65b07694bfdf9d7fda.json",
],
],
},
Expand Down Expand Up @@ -3445,7 +3445,7 @@ exports[`Snapshot test for primary devopsDashboardStack 1`] = `
"S3Bucket": {
"Fn::Sub": "cdk-hnb659fds-assets-\${AWS::AccountId}-\${AWS::Region}",
},
"S3Key": "abc87bd4517df441ed5309fbcfb9ab524c534140bb36466f4a048f003ca8119b.zip",
"S3Key": "1c5ebab0200a0dfa0fce2de4d1bacdc859692a8e4d909e125b93845a9a77b662.zip",
},
"Description": "DevOps Monitoring Dashboard on AWS solution - This function runs Amazon Athena queries and creates views.",
"Environment": {
Expand Down Expand Up @@ -3745,7 +3745,7 @@ exports[`Snapshot test for primary devopsDashboardStack 1`] = `
"S3Bucket": {
"Fn::Sub": "cdk-hnb659fds-assets-\${AWS::AccountId}-\${AWS::Region}",
},
"S3Key": "de07b6690f7a65f513686edcffa9c22a959abe44be28bd396fd5eb9d1ef4bbc2.zip",
"S3Key": "36d76be94eb3ea0942000ff5c85649a81dc4108f4d38873eea5e1eeed51f9b05.zip",
},
"Description": "DevOps Monitoring Dashboard on AWS solution - This function queries CodeCommit, CodeBuild, and CodePipeline resources for tag information.",
"Environment": {
Expand Down Expand Up @@ -4362,7 +4362,7 @@ exports[`Snapshot test for primary devopsDashboardStack 1`] = `
"S3Bucket": {
"Fn::Sub": "cdk-hnb659fds-assets-\${AWS::AccountId}-\${AWS::Region}",
},
"S3Key": "17e67cb7c6ad51f229b1ad93d8bdb8ea43095897bc2367dc7e7d82d6294905f7.zip",
"S3Key": "b404e24280e6982a4258a224453b8ab186e036785b4ee7219839006574024def.zip",
},
"Description": "DevOps Monitoring Dashboard on AWS solution - This function manages permissions in the central monitoring account that are required for processing metrics sent by other accounts.",
"Environment": {
Expand Down
4 changes: 2 additions & 2 deletions source/test/__snapshots__/sharing_account_stack.test.ts.snap
Original file line number Diff line number Diff line change
Expand Up @@ -290,7 +290,7 @@ exports[`Snapshot test for primary SharingAccountStack 1`] = `
"S3Bucket": {
"Fn::Sub": "cdk-hnb659fds-assets-\${AWS::AccountId}-\${AWS::Region}",
},
"S3Key": "988d6a83d1cb17697e7f9d239ca7089b2310e30e1a432a2d33f3caddf135b3d7.zip",
"S3Key": "240e359dfbddd5a1f34a91445a3224f32a4fb1859012c760306c1e654e3b65f5.zip",
},
"Description": "DevOps Monitoring Dashboard on AWS solution - This function performs lambda transformation within kinesis firehose. It parses CloudWatch metrics for CodeBuild, sends relevant data to S3 for downstream operation",
"Environment": {
Expand Down Expand Up @@ -1204,7 +1204,7 @@ exports[`Snapshot test for primary SharingAccountStack 1`] = `
"S3Bucket": {
"Fn::Sub": "cdk-hnb659fds-assets-\${AWS::AccountId}-\${AWS::Region}",
},
"S3Key": "de07b6690f7a65f513686edcffa9c22a959abe44be28bd396fd5eb9d1ef4bbc2.zip",
"S3Key": "36d76be94eb3ea0942000ff5c85649a81dc4108f4d38873eea5e1eeed51f9b05.zip",
},
"Description": "DevOps Monitoring Dashboard on AWS solution - This function queries CodeCommit, CodeBuild, and CodePipeline resources for tag information.",
"Environment": {
Expand Down

0 comments on commit 2e79c65

Please sign in to comment.